A heavy, oblique sans with smooth, rounded curves and compact counters. Strokes are broadly even, with softly modulated joins and terminals that read clean and contemporary rather than calligraphic. Proportions feel slightly condensed and forward-leaning, with a consistent rhythm across uppercase and lowercase; bowls are full and circular, while diagonals and stems stay sturdy and uniform. Numerals are robust and simple, designed to hold their shape at display sizes.
Best suited to headlines, posters, and hero text where strong, slanted emphasis is desirable. It works well for sports and lifestyle branding, packaging callouts, and promotional graphics that need a modern, energetic voice. For extended reading, its dense color suggests using generous tracking and comfortable line spacing.
The slanted posture and solid weight give the face a sense of speed and momentum, lending a sporty, headline-driven tone. Its rounded geometry keeps the mood friendly and approachable, while the dense color and firm structure communicate confidence and immediacy.
The design appears intended as an assertive display sans that combines geometric roundness with an oblique stance for motion and emphasis. Its sturdy construction prioritizes impact and clarity in short phrases, making it effective for attention-grabbing typography in contemporary visual systems.
Letterforms show compact apertures and relatively small counters in several shapes, which increases darkness and punch in short lines. The overall silhouette is smooth and cohesive, emphasizing curved construction over sharp corners for a streamlined, modern feel.
